Ground Turkey Potato Skillet Ingredients
For the Skillet Base
- Ground Turkey – A lean protein option; opt for 93/7 for a great balance of flavor and health.
- Potatoes – Choose Yukon Gold or red potatoes for their buttery texture; keeping the skin adds nutrition.
- Tomato Sauce – A rich, flavorful base; high-quality San Marzano tomatoes can elevate your dish significantly.
For Seasoning
- Garlic – Fresh is best! Use minced garlic for an aromatic punch; about 2 teaspoons if using jarred will do.
- Dried Herbs (Oregano, Basil, etc.) – They add depth; consider using fresh herbs for a brighter flavor—use three times the amount!
- Spices (Salt, Pepper, etc.) – Essential for enhancing all the flavors; adjust to suit your taste.
For Cooking
- Oil – Olive or avocado oil works wonders; avocado oil has a higher smoke point if you prefer that.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Ground Turkey Potato Skillet
Step 1: Prep Ingredients
Begin by gathering your ingredients to create a seamless cooking experience. Wash the potatoes thoroughly and dice them into ½-inch cubes for even cooking. Mince about two teaspoons of fresh garlic (or use jarred), and set everything aside. Having your Ground Turkey Potato Skillet ingredients prepped and ready ensures you can swiftly transition from one step to the next.
Step 2: Cook Turkey
In a large sk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ive or avocado oil over medium-high heat until it shimmers, about 2-3 minutes. Add the ground turkey, breaking it up with a spatula as it cooks. Season with salt and pepper. Sauté for 6-8 minutes or until the turkey is browned and cooked through, stirring occasionally to ensure even cooking and to develop flavor for your Ground Turkey Potato Skillet.
Step 3: Brown Potatoes
Once the turkey is cooked, push it to one side of the skillet and add the diced potatoes to the other side. Allow them to brown for about 5-7 minutes without stirring too much to achieve a nice crispness. After this time, toss the turkey with the potatoes, ensuring they mingle while continuing to cook the potatoes until they are golden and starting to soften—this will enhance the dish's overall texture.
Step 4: Combine Ingredients
Stir in the minced garlic, about a cup of tomato sauce, and your choice of dried herbs, such as oregano and basil. Mix everything well to ensure the flavors meld together. Let the Ground Turkey Potato Skillet simmer for an additional 5-7 minutes over medium heat. The potatoes should be fork-tender, and the sauce thickened slightly, wrapping each ingredient in delightful flavor.
Step 5: Serve
Check the potatoes for tenderness, and once they are fork-tender, remove the skillet from the heat. Ladle the hearty Ground Turkey Potato Skillet into bowls and garnish with freshly chopped parsley or grated Parmesan cheese if desired. Make Ahead Options
This Ground Turkey & Potato Skillet is perfect for meal prep enthusiasts looking to save time during busy weeknights! You can dice the potatoes and store them in an airtight container with a splash of water for up to 24 hours to prevent browning. Additionally, you can brown the ground turkey and sauté garlic, allowing you to mix them into the skillet with ease later. When ready to serve, simply combine the prepped ingredients in a skillet, add tomato sauce, and cook until the potatoes are fork-tender, which saves valuable time without sacrificing flavor. Storage Tips for Ground Turkey Potato Skillet
-
Room Temperature: Allow the skillet to cool to room temperature before storing. Do not leave out for more than 2 hours to prevent bacteria growth.
-
Fridge: Store in an airtight container, and it will last for up to 5 days in the refrigerator. Reheat on the stove or microwave with a splash of water to maintain moisture.
-
Freezer: Freeze for up to 3 months in a freezer-safe container. For best results, let it th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.
-
Reheating: When reheating, add a splash of water or broth to keep the Ground Turkey Potato Skillet moist, ensuring every bite remains delicious and flavorful.
Expert Tips for Ground Turkey Potato Skillet
-
Ingredient Prep: Gather and dice all ingredients before starting. This not only speeds up the cooking process but ensures even cooking in your Ground Turkey Potato Skillet.
-
Right Skillet Size: Use a large enough skillet to prevent overcrowding. Overcrowded ingredients may steam instead of brown, which could result in a less flavorful dish.
-
Brown the Potatoes: Always brown your potatoes before adding other ingredients. This helps develop a caramelized flavor that elevates your meal significantly.
-
Lean Turkey Caution: If using lean ground turkey, avoid draining it unless there’s excessive liquid. The moisture can contribute to a juicier Ground Turkey Potato Skillet.
-
Stirring Cycle: When adding in the potatoes, resist the urge to stir too often. Letting them brown properly will enhance texture and flavor, making all the difference!
Ground Turkey Potato Skillet Recipe FAQs
What type of potatoes should I use for the Ground Turkey Potato Skillet?
I recommend using Yukon Gold or red potatoes for their buttery texture and ability to hold their shape during cooking. Keeping the skin on adds not only nutrition but also extra flavor.
How can I store leftover Ground Turkey Potato Skillet?
After allowing it to cool to room temperature, transfer the skillet contents to an airtight container. It can last in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Just remember to reheat it on the stove or microwave with a splash of water for the best results!
Can I freeze the Ground Turkey Potato Skillet?
Absolutely! To freeze, cool the skillet completely, then transfer it to a freezer-safe container. It will keep well for up to 3 months. When you're ready to enjoy it again, thaw it in the fridge overnight and reheat with a little water to keep it moist.
What if my potatoes aren’t browning properly?
If your potatoes aren’t browning, it’s likely that the skillet is overcrowded. I suggest using a larger skillet or working in batches to allow for proper browning. Also, avoid stirring them too often; let them sit and develop that beautiful color for a few minutes!
Is this Ground Turkey Potato Skillet suitable for gluten-free diets?
Yes, indeed! This recipe is naturally gluten-free as it uses simple whole ingredients without any additives or gluten-containing products. Just be sure to check the labels on your tomato sauce to ensure it's gluten-free if you use a pre-made variety.
